Transaction 33f2e852364277442af940b470f39c5d900045458c3ebe336fd0ce16ecb8d422

1 Input
2 Outputs
  • 33f2e852364277442af940b470f39c5d900045458c3ebe336fd0ce16ecb8d422:0
  • value  21462000
    address  1PidpXQCoGVDwgWv2RkkG9eQBcdCtiDHGK
  • 33f2e852364277442af940b470f39c5d900045458c3ebe336fd0ce16ecb8d422:1
  • value  114422705
    address  3HBDYebtsitPNc4nyM3rk5sb12rpR4mnP1